М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
даша3643
даша3643
13.01.2020 06:04 •  Информатика

Вводится n натуральных чисел. найти минимальное, кратное 7. если такого числа нет, вывести "нет".
с++

👇
Ответ:
annvggf
annvggf
13.01.2020

#include <iostream>

using namespace std;

int main()

{

   int n, temp, min = 2000000000;

   cin >> n;

   while (n--) {

       cin >> temp;

       if (temp%7==0&&temp<min) min = temp;

   }

   if (min == 2000000000) cout << "НЕТ";

   else cout << min;

}

4,5(26 оценок)
Открыть все ответы
Ответ:
cerenkovvladimi
cerenkovvladimi
13.01.2020

первое задание:  1. Необходимо следить за адресами, на которые ведут ссылки. Для того чтобы узнать адрес, на который ведет ссылка необходимо просто навести на нее курсор. Если вам предлагают перейти на сайт Х, а ссылка ведет на сайт Y то тут что-то не так. Возможно, вас пытаются обмануть.

2. Перед вводом личной информации проверяйте адресную строку браузера. Если вы там увидите что то вроде vkontokte.ru вместо привычного vkontakte.ru, то можете быть уверены, что вы находитесь на поддельном сайте и у вас пытаются украсть пароль для доступа к вашему аккаунту. После получения данных злоумышленники могут использовать аккаунт для рассылки спама и вирусов вашим друзьям.

3. Не переходите по незнакомым ссылкам, которые приходят вам на почту, в «аську», или в социальные сети. Даже если ссылка пришла от знакомого человека необходимо быть максимально внимательным. Вполне возможно аккаунт вашего знакомого уже взломан, и теперь от его имени рассылают вирусы.

4. Не скачивайте неизвестные файлы, пришедшие вам на почту или в «аську», даже если файл пришел от вашего знакомого. Перед тем как скачивать такие файлы уточните у отправителя, что это за файл.

5. Современные поисковые системы и браузеры умеют предупреждать пользователя, когда он пытается зайти на сайт распространяющий вирусы. Необходимо внимательно относиться к таким предупреждениям, скорее всего сайт, который вы пытаетесь посетить, заражен.

2 задание 1  Длина пароля. Пароль должен содержать не менее 8 символов, а лучше – 10 и более.

2 Наличие цифр и букв верхнего и нижнего регистров, идущих не подряд – .

3 Наличие специальных знаков – «@», «$», «&» и т.д. (если допустимо их присутствие).

пример [email protected]

Объяснение:

4,4(59 оценок)
Ответ:
LianessaAngel2
LianessaAngel2
13.01.2020
Одно из решений, возможно, не самое эффективное
#include <iostream>
#include <iomanip>
int main()
{
    using namespace std;

    //исходная последовательность
    const int N = 8;
    double Arr[N] = { 14.2, -3.4, 7.8, -3.1, 8.2, 98.22, -7, 12 };

    //вывод на экран исходной последовательности
    for (int i = 0; i < N; ++i)
        cout << Arr[i] << "  ";
    cout << endl;

    //подсчитаем количества отрицательных и неотрицательных элементов
    int kpos = 0;
    int kneg = 0;
    for (int i = 0; i < N; ++i)
        if (Arr[i] < 0)
            ++kneg;
        else
            ++kpos;

    //создадим массивы отрицательных и неотрицательных элементов
    double * ArrNeg = new double[kneg];
    double * ArrPos = new double[kpos];

    int kn = 0, kp = 0;
    for (int i = 0; i < N; i++)
        if (Arr[i] < 0)
            ArrNeg[kn++] = Arr[i];
        else
            ArrPos[kp++] = Arr[i];

    cout << "Enter a, b, c or d: ";
    char ch;
    cin >> ch;

    if (ch == 'a' || ch == 'b' || ch == 'c' || ch == 'd')
    {
        switch (ch)
        {
            //пункт а)
            case 'a':
                for (int i = 0; i < kneg; ++i)
                    Arr[i] = ArrNeg[i];
                for (int i = 0; i < kpos; ++i)
                    Arr[i + kneg] = ArrPos[i];
                break;

                //пункт б)
            case 'b':
                for (int i = 0; i < kneg; ++i)
                    Arr[i] = ArrNeg[--kn];
                for (int i = 0; i < kpos; ++i)
                    Arr[i + kneg] = ArrPos[i];
                break;

                //пункт в)
            case 'c':
                for (int i = 0; i < kneg; ++i)
                    Arr[i] = ArrNeg[i];
                for (int i = 0; i < kpos; ++i)
                    Arr[i + kneg] = ArrPos[--kp];
                break;

                //пункт г)
            case 'd':
                for (int i = 0; i < kneg; ++i)
                    Arr[i] = ArrNeg[--kn];
                for (int i = 0; i < kpos; ++i)
                    Arr[i + kneg] = ArrPos[--kp];
                break;
        }
    }
    else
        cout << "You entered wrong symbol\n";

    for (int i = 0; i < N; ++i)
        cout << Arr[i] << "  ";
    cout << endl;
    delete[] ArrNeg;
    delete[] ArrPos;
    return 0;
}
4,8(77 оценок)
Это интересно:
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